Where is Wonderful Family Home in the Heart of Montreat located?

Situated in the mountains, this holiday home is within a 10-minute walk of Robert Lake Park and Ten Thousand Villages. Pisgah National Forest and The Merry Wine Market are also within 3 miles (5 km).

Wonderful Stay in Montreat!
A chuch group of 10 members stayed in this updated, spacious, and beautiful 1920s home. Over time, there have been several additions which resulted in some interesting characteristics to the home, yet the updates were performed in an extraordinary manner. The kitchen is large and well appointed with two refrigerators available. Great for a large group. Beyond the home itself, the greatest attributes were its location, ample parking (which is very unusual for Montreat), and the frequent and responsive communications with the owner. When we arrived, the home had a new disherwasher but it was not fully installed. The owned communicated this to us and effectivly coordinated its prompt installation. Being a home built in the 1920s, a person with mobility issues would have challenges. Some passages are not wide enough for a standard wheelchair, all entrances to the home have stairs, some doorways have unlevel entryways, all bedrooms are upstairs (with one of the two staircases being rather steep), and the bathooms did not have rails. Additionally, several of the bedrooms had limited storage for clothing. Unless one of these items is a show-stopper for you, I highly recommend this property. I certainly hope to stay here in the future!
